> Below is a patch for the $SUBJECT bz. I originally just changed the case of the
> search string to match what 'yum resolvedep' was printing, but then I thought
about
> whether folks might not have the changed version of yum...
>
> After I took an aspirin to deal with the dependency combinatorial explosion
headache,
> I looked at the code again. I didn't really want to pull in the re package just
for
> this one case, so I resorted to doing a case-insensitive match, which I *hope* will
> deal with most cases.
>
> What do you guys think?
>
> Clark
>
> diff --git a/mock.py b/mock.py
> index 54b8f8c..35c3592 100644
> - --- a/mock.py
> +++ b/mock.py
> @@ -355,9 +355,11 @@ class Root:
> # pass build reqs (as strings) to installer
> if arg_string != "":
> (retval, output) = self.yum('resolvedep %s' % arg_string)
> + searchstr = 'no package found for'
> for line in output.split('\n'):
> - - if line.find('No Package found for') != -1:
> - - errorpkg = line.replace('No Package found for',
'')
> + idx = line.lower().find(searchstr)
> + if idx != -1:
> + errorpkg = line[idx+len(searchstr):]
> error(output)
> raise BuildError, "Cannot find build req %s. Exiting."
% errorpkg
> # nothing made us exit, so we continue
